    Flash Cards

    I use Access 2016

    In building a basic Access "flash card" program, any suggestion on how to random sort one column for "Term" to flash?
    My table would have columns for "Type," "Term," and "Definition"
    My "Type" would include medical, Access, general, etc.

    Even a pre-rolled such Access db would be helpful

    Any help would be appreciated
